KDA-Slider-3Kilkeel Development Association (KDA), was established in 1991 with the main aim of addressing the physical, social and economic decline of Kilkeel, brought about primarily by the decline in the town’s core industries of fishing, farming and construction. It brings together a range of skills and expertise across its 10 members, who are drawn from all sections of the community and who have worked tirelessly over the past twenty one years to identify and implement key projects which seek to regenerate our area, create employment and add value to the local economy.

To date KDA has facilitated the investment of over £10 million into the town for a wide range of integrated projects which have created employment, provided major community facilities and services, facilitated tourism development, enhanced community relations and the local environment. The KDA was formed as a sister organisation to the Kilkeel Chamber of Commerce.

Even in 2013, we are now suffering the worst economic downturn in living memory and therefore KDA is needed even more now than when it was first established. Kilkeel is suffering from high levels of unemployment, and mass youth emigration. There are high levels of deprivation, especially in rural areas and certain wards within the area. There is generally low level of educational attainment, however those who do progress to third level education, rarely return to the area. The downturn in the construction sector from 2007 has been felt especially hard in the area, as it was a hub for building skills. Kilkeel has still a high level of offshore skills through the traditional fishing sector and therefore the opportunities will stem from additional training and retraining those who have a high skill level in order to take advantage of new emerging sectors such as the offshore energy sector.

Kilkeel Charitable Trust has been formed as the charitable umbrella organisation for Kilkeel Development Association; so that the work and buildings of KDA remain in charitable perpetuation for the local community of the wider Kilkeel area. Kilkeel Charitable Trust will also aim to develop a range of projects aimed at enhancing and enriching the social environment for Kilkeel’s resident’s.
